UCC Filing in Oregon: A Comprehensive Overview of the Different Types What is UCC Filing in Oregon? UCC filing, also known as Uniform Commercial Code filing, is a legal process that enables individuals, businesses, and lenders to publicly declare their secured interest in personal property. In Oregon, UCC filing is governed by the Oregon Secretary of State's office and the Oregon Revised Statutes. UCC-1 Financing Statement: The UCC-1 Financing Statement is the most common type of UCC filing in Oregon. It allows lenders or creditors to establish their secured interest in the personal property of a debtor. This filing ensures that the lender's claim on the collateral takes priority over other claims in case of default or bankruptcy. UCC-3 Financing Statement Amendment: UCC-3 Financing Statement Amendment is a type of UCC filing used to modify or amend information provided in the original UCC-1 Financing Statement. This amendment can include changes in debtor information, collateral description, or additional collateral being pledged, among other necessary modifications. Before you can file a lien in Texas, you must first send a notice of intent to the owner, general contractor, and other interested parties. This notice must be sent no later than the 15th day of the third month following the month in which you provided labor or materials to the project.

Ing to Louisiana law, a judgment lien remains valid for a period of 10 years. If the 10 year period passes and the funds are still owed on the judgment, there may be steps required in order to preserve your ability to collect on the judgment.

There are three general steps to filing a mechanics lien in Louisiana: Complete the Louisiana Statement of Claim and Privilege form. Record the claim form with the recorder of mortgages office in the parish where the property is located. Serve notice of the lien claim to the property owner.
